Myron Bertram Case was born in 1934 in Detroit, Wayne, Michigan, USA, the child of Myron Mead Case And Lillian Maggie Mackie. In 1935, Myron Bertram Case resided in Detroit, Wayne, Michigan. In 1940, Myron Bertram Case resided in , Detroit, Wayne, Michigan, USA. Myron Bertram Case married Lola Mae Zebott, and had children including Tamara Colleen Case Belich. Myron Bertram Case passed away in 1988 in Duluth, St. Louis County, Minnesota, United States of America.
